Job Summary

The Resident Director for Summer School Intern is considered a temporary, full-time professional staff member of the Residence Education team within University Housing. While this individual works most closely with members of the Residence Education team, they have opportunities to become involved in the operations of other units within University Housing. The intern will gain first-hand exposure to the daily complexities and challenges of departmental operations and will have the opportunity to network and understand the relationship between University Housing and other student services at the university.

Temporary employees are employed according to departmental need and the length of time will vary by workload and may not exceed 1300 hours worked in a 12-consecutive month period.

Responsibilities
  • Directly supervise and train up to 8 resident advisors
  • Conduct bi-weekly one-on-one meetings with resident advisors
  • Coordinate and facilitate a minimum of 3 staff meetings over the summer semester
  • Oversee operations of an apartment community with around 150 residential students
  • Implement a Residential Curriculum (e.g., Educational Programming) for residential students
  • Serve as an informal hearing officer adjudicating violations of the Code of Student Conduct and Residential Community Guide
  • Serve on a second-tier on-call rotation, responding to maintenance and crisis situations
  • Participate in department initiatives
